Working Principles

CGL-25 operates based on the principle of feedback control. It compares the output voltage to a reference voltage and adjusts the internal circuitry to maintain a constant output voltage despite changes in input voltage or load conditions. This feedback loop ensures stability and accuracy in the regulated output.
